Friday, October 10

Generative AI: Art, Ethics, And The Algorithmic Muse

Generative AI is rapidly transforming industries, from creative arts to software development and beyond. This powerful technology is capable of producing new content, including text, images, audio, and even code, opening up exciting possibilities for innovation and automation. Understanding its capabilities and applications is crucial for businesses and individuals alike who want to leverage its potential.

What is Generative AI?

Understanding the Core Concepts

Generative AI refers to a class of artificial intelligence algorithms that can generate new, original content. Unlike traditional AI systems that focus on analyzing or classifying existing data, generative AI models learn the underlying patterns and structures within a dataset and then use that knowledge to create entirely new data points that resemble the training data. These models leverage techniques like deep learning, particularly architectures like Generative Adversarial Networks (GANs) and Variational Autoencoders (VAEs).

Key Techniques Used in Generative AI

  • Generative Adversarial Networks (GANs): GANs consist of two neural networks: a generator, which creates new data, and a discriminator, which evaluates the authenticity of the generated data. These two networks compete against each other, with the generator trying to fool the discriminator and the discriminator trying to identify fake data. This adversarial process leads to the generator producing increasingly realistic outputs.
  • Variational Autoencoders (VAEs): VAEs are probabilistic models that learn a compressed representation of the input data (latent space). They consist of an encoder, which maps the input data to the latent space, and a decoder, which reconstructs the input data from the latent space representation. By sampling from the latent space and feeding it to the decoder, VAEs can generate new data points that resemble the training data.
  • Transformer Models: Transformer models, particularly large language models (LLMs), have proven highly effective in generating text, code, and other sequential data. These models utilize a self-attention mechanism to weigh the importance of different parts of the input sequence when generating the output. Models like GPT (Generative Pre-trained Transformer) and BERT (Bidirectional Encoder Representations from Transformers) are examples of powerful transformer-based generative AI.

Applications of Generative AI Across Industries

Content Creation and Marketing

Generative AI is revolutionizing content creation and marketing by automating tasks such as writing blog posts, generating social media captions, and even creating advertising copy. Tools powered by generative AI can produce high-quality content quickly and efficiently, freeing up human creators to focus on more strategic and creative tasks.

  • Example: Jasper.ai, a popular AI writing assistant, can generate blog posts, marketing emails, website copy, and more based on user prompts and keywords. This can significantly speed up content production and improve marketing ROI.

Art and Design

Generative AI is being used to create stunning works of art, design unique products, and generate visual effects for movies and games. AI models can produce images, videos, and music that are indistinguishable from human-created content, opening up new possibilities for artistic expression and design innovation.

  • Example: DALL-E 2 and Midjourney are AI image generators that can create realistic images from text descriptions. Users can input prompts like “a cat wearing sunglasses riding a skateboard” and the AI will generate an image based on that description.

Software Development

Generative AI can assist software developers by generating code, suggesting code improvements, and even automating the creation of entire software applications. This can significantly improve developer productivity and reduce the time and cost of software development.

  • Example: GitHub Copilot is an AI pair programmer that suggests code completions and entire code blocks based on the context of the code being written. This can help developers write code faster and more efficiently.

Healthcare

Generative AI is being used in healthcare to develop new drugs, personalize treatment plans, and generate synthetic medical images for training purposes. AI models can analyze vast amounts of medical data to identify patterns and insights that would be difficult or impossible for humans to detect.

  • Example: Generative AI can be used to generate synthetic MRI scans of the brain for training radiologists. This allows them to practice diagnosing diseases and conditions without having to rely on real patient data.

Benefits of Using Generative AI

Increased Efficiency and Productivity

Generative AI can automate repetitive tasks and generate content much faster than humans, leading to significant gains in efficiency and productivity.

  • Example: Instead of spending hours writing a blog post, a marketer can use an AI writing assistant to generate a draft in minutes, freeing up time to focus on other tasks.

Enhanced Creativity and Innovation

Generative AI can help humans explore new ideas and create unique and innovative products and services.

  • Example: A designer can use an AI image generator to create multiple design options based on different prompts, allowing them to explore a wider range of possibilities.

Reduced Costs

Generative AI can automate tasks that would otherwise require human labor, leading to significant cost savings.

  • Example: A company can use an AI chatbot to handle customer service inquiries, reducing the need for human customer service representatives.

Personalization and Customization

Generative AI can be used to personalize content, products, and services to meet the unique needs of individual customers.

  • Example: An e-commerce company can use generative AI to create personalized product recommendations based on a customer’s past purchases and browsing history.

Challenges and Ethical Considerations

Bias and Fairness

Generative AI models can perpetuate and amplify biases present in the training data, leading to unfair or discriminatory outcomes. It is crucial to carefully curate training data and implement techniques to mitigate bias.

Misinformation and Deepfakes

Generative AI can be used to create realistic but fake content, such as deepfakes, which can be used to spread misinformation and damage reputations. It is important to develop techniques to detect and combat deepfakes and other forms of AI-generated misinformation.

Job Displacement

The automation potential of generative AI raises concerns about job displacement in certain industries. It is important to invest in education and training programs to help workers adapt to the changing job market.

Intellectual Property Rights

The use of generative AI raises complex questions about intellectual property rights. Who owns the copyright to content generated by AI models? It is important to establish clear legal frameworks to address these issues.

Getting Started with Generative AI

Choosing the Right Tools and Platforms

There are many different generative AI tools and platforms available, each with its own strengths and weaknesses. It is important to choose the right tools and platforms for your specific needs and goals.

  • Consider: Your budget, the type of content you want to generate, and your level of technical expertise.

Experimentation and Iteration

Generative AI is still a relatively new technology, and it takes time and effort to master. Experiment with different prompts and settings to see what works best for you.

  • Tip: Start with small, simple projects and gradually work your way up to more complex tasks.

Monitoring and Evaluation

It is important to monitor and evaluate the output of generative AI models to ensure that they are producing high-quality and accurate results.

  • Use: Metrics such as accuracy, relevance, and coherence to assess the performance of generative AI models.

Conclusion

Generative AI represents a paradigm shift in how we create and interact with content. Its potential to enhance creativity, automate tasks, and personalize experiences is immense. While challenges like bias and ethical considerations need careful attention, the transformative power of generative AI is undeniable. By understanding its capabilities, applications, and limitations, businesses and individuals can harness its power to unlock new possibilities and drive innovation across various sectors. The future is undoubtedly shaped by generative AI, and embracing its potential is key to staying ahead in a rapidly evolving world.

Read our previous article: Altcoins: Beyond Bitcoin, Unlocking Tomorrows Financial Frontiers

Read more about AI & Tech

Leave a Reply

Your email address will not be published. Required fields are marked *